LINES LEAVES HIS RUN LATE IN WIN

Race fans treated to high quality speedway action

-

SPEEDWAY: A patient and precise performanc­e helped Steven Lines win round one of the Ultimate Sprintcar Championsh­ip Qld at the weekend.

With race leader Robbie Farr slowed by lapped traffic, South Australian Lines snatched the lead with three laps left to claim victory at HiTec Oils Toowoomba Speedway.

Farr, who recorded the fastest qualifying time, led every lap of the A-Main until Lines got by.

“We were probably a little too good too early,” Farr said.

“But full credit to Linesy for getting us in traffic. It’s a good start for us on the first night of the season though.

“We tried something with the set up and it could have gone either way. You can’t always get it right but we’re fast and it’s going to be a great season.”

Lines was naturally delighted with the win.

“I made a conscious effort not to be too aggressive at the start so we had to settle in and start to pick our way through,” he said.

“We were able to use the traffic a bit in turn four and come up with the win. I can’t wait to get back here for the 50lapper in two weeks’ time.”

Already delayed by a brief rain shower the 30-lap A-Main was halted before a lap was recorded when Mick Saller and Tony Wynne rolled over and brought on the red lights.

At the restart Farr shot from third to first within two corners to lead down the back straight from Brent Kratzmann and Lines before contact between Mark Pholi and Andrew Corbett saw the yellows come on with only one lap in the books.

In the Modified Sedans, Toowoomba’s Rodney Parmentier showed plenty of early pace, finishing second in both his heats before winning the feature race.

“I’m happy with the win. It’s a great way to start the season,” he said.

Hi-Tec Oils Toowoomba Speedway public relations official David Budden was delighted with the opening meet of the new season.

“The racing was fantastic,” he said.

“The quality of car and driver was among the best you’ll see anywhere in Australia.

“It was good to see plenty of local drivers on the pace as well.”
